New explosion heard in central Baghdad

An explosion sounded across central Baghdad today and smoke rose above the commercial district, witnesses said.

There was no immediate explanation for the cause of the blast, which went off about eight hours after a car bomb exploded at an entrance to the headquarters of the US led coalition, killing the head of the Iraqi Governing Council, Mr Izzedin Salim.
